Abstract

845,725. Spinning &c. machines. SHUFORD MILLS Inc. July 2, 1957 [Jan. 22, 1957], No. 20842/57. Class 120(2). [Also in Group XXIV] In a spinning &c. machine having a reciprocating traverse and winding spindles driven from a common shaft, a variable-speed drive is coupled to the shaft and is operated by a fluid-pressure system including a regulator valve, means being provided which respond to movement of the traverse in one direction to open the valve and to movement in the opposite direction to close it. In the ring-spinning machine shown, packages are wound on bobbins having cone-shaped lower portions so that the diameter of the package decreases on the up-stroke and increases on the downstroke of the traverse; the aim being to decrease the speed of winding on the up-stroke to avoid placing the yarn under tension, and to increase the speed on the down-stroke. The spindles and the builder-motion are driven from a shaft 16 to which a variable-speed drive is transmitted from a motor 60 through pulley pairs 74, 61 ; the upper pair are each of the expanding-type described in Specification 845,722 and the motor is resiliently mounted e.g. as described in Specification 845,724. The pulleys 61 expand or contract under control of a piston on a cylinder 102 which in turn is controlled by a valve 120 operated by a lever 150 linked at 151 to a pivoted extension of the arm of the builder motion at 30, which extension moves down as the arm moves up with each downward movement of the ring-rail and vice versa. With each down movement of the extension the link is pulled to move the arm 150 to the right and gradually to open the valve 120 and admit air under pressure to the cylinder 102 to enlarge the effective diameter of the pulleys and increase the speed of the drive. With each up movement of the extension, a spring 154 in the link, tensioned during the down stroke, is relaxed to allow the arm 150 to move to the left and close the valve, whereby the air supply is cut off and a subsidiary valve opened gradually to exhaust the pressure in the cylinder. The subsidiary valve is adjustable to determine either the maximum or the minimum spindle-speed; in the one case it can be adjusted to open to exhaust the pressure when it attains a level to correspond to the desired maximum speed; in the other case, it can be adjusted to close when the pressure falls to correspond to the desired minimum speed. The maximum and minimum speeds may also be determined to some extent by the stroke of the piston. When it is desired to build "bunches" at the foot of the spindle instead of using bobbins with coneshaped bottoms, the valve 120 is caused to remain open for winding to proceed at uniform minimum speed. To this end, the link 151 can be disconnected: or a valve can be interposed on the pressure line to be opened by a solenoid through a switch which is operated only after the desired number of strokes have been made by the traverse.
